On our first day in San Francisco we visited Lombard Street, the world's crookedest. The films make it look a lot bigger than it really is. The next day we went to Alcatraz with a friend we met in Fiji. We took the audio tour which was really good and meant we could go at our own pace. It was really interesting learning about the history of the prison and attempted breakouts. We also met a former prisoner there #1422 (AKA Darwin Coon). He wasn't very talkative but we bought his book and he signed it for us. After Alcatraz we visited the biggest Chinatown outside of China for a great Chinese, something the 3 of us dreamt about in Fiji.
A few days later we hired bikes to explore more of the city. We visited Ocean Beach, Golden Gate park and rode over Golden Gate bridge to Sausalito where we caught the ferry back. We also saw a man and dog swimming in the freezing water being followed by a pack of seals which was cool.
We were up early the following day for our day trip to Yosemite NP. It was a great trip and included all the main attractions, Half Dome, El Capitan and Yostemite Falls. We also did a short hike to see the giant Sequoia trees which WERE massive. It was a really beautiful place and we could have spent longer exploring.
On our last day we walked to Alamo Square to check out the Painted Ladies Victorian houses to take one of the most taken photos in San Fran. That afternoon we indulged in some retail therapy before our flight to Las Vegas.
